#93597e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#93597e is composed of 57.6% red, 34.9%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.5% magenta, 14.3%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 321.7 degrees, a saturation of 24.6% and a lightness of 46.3%. #93597e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b2fc with #270000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#93597e color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.
#93597e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#93597e has RGB values of R:147, G:89,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.14,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9656702.
